Our nickel alloy plates, conforming to ASTM B162 standards with designations N02201 and N02200, are a remarkable solution for various industrial applications. These plates are crafted from high - quality nickel - based precision alloy, which is known for its exceptional performance and reliability in challenging environments.
Nickel - Based Precision Alloy: The core of these plates is a nickel - based alloy. Nickel is a key element that provides excellent corrosion resistance, high ductility, and good thermal stability. The specific composition of the alloy in our N02201 and N02200 plates is carefully formulated to meet the strict requirements of ASTM B162.
Corrosion Resistance: One of the most outstanding features of these plates is their good resistance to corrosion. They can withstand a wide range of corrosive substances, including acids, alkalis, and salt - water environments. This makes them ideal for use in chemical processing plants, marine applications, and other industries where corrosion is a major concern.
Thermal Stability: These nickel alloy plates maintain their mechanical properties over a wide temperature range. Whether in high - temperature industrial furnaces or cold - storage facilities, they can perform consistently, ensuring the long - term stability of the structures and equipment they are used in.
The plates undergo a polishing surface treatment. This not only gives them an attractive silver - colored finish but also provides several functional benefits.
Smooth Surface: The polished surface reduces friction, which can be beneficial in applications where materials need to slide or flow over the plate. It also makes the plates easier to clean, which is crucial in industries with strict hygiene requirements, such as food processing and pharmaceuticals.
Enhanced Corrosion Resistance: The polishing process can create a more uniform surface, which further improves the plate's resistance to corrosion. It helps to prevent the formation of crevices and pits where corrosion could initiate.

These nickel alloy plates have a wide range of applications across various industries.
Chemical Industry: In chemical processing plants, they are used in reaction vessels, storage tanks, and piping systems. Their corrosion resistance ensures that they can handle aggressive chemicals without degradation.
Marine Industry: For shipbuilding and offshore platforms, the plates are used in hull structures, decks, and equipment. Their ability to resist salt - water corrosion helps to extend the lifespan of marine vessels and structures.
Electronics Industry: In electronic devices, the plates can be used as heat sinks or conductive components due to their good thermal and electrical conductivity.
Food and Beverage Industry: The polished surface and corrosion resistance make the plates suitable for use in food processing equipment, such as mixing tanks and conveyor belts, where hygiene and durability are essential.
